On this week's episode of the Niche Pursuits podcast, Keyword Chef founder Ben Adler highlights the proven tactics he's learned over the years to go after the right topics and grow several successful niche sites.
These are the same strategies he built into the filtering system of his popular keyword research tool - ensuring users can discover the most high-value, low-competition keywords available.
And he talks about how you can use and benefit from these strategies!
He shares important insights on:
* Understanding search intent
* How to assess and analyze low-competition in the SERPs
* Using keyword research to help with niche selection
* Common keyword research mistakes
* And many more topics that'll bring you tons of value...
